Shrewsbury School seeks to appoint a full-time teacher of Business and/or Economics to teach at A Level in one or both of these successful, supportive, and collaborative Faculties.
This role would be ideal for someone new to the profession (with or without formal qualifications) looking to gain initial experience, key skills and knowledge in one of the country’s leading boarding schools, or for an experienced teacher looking for their next challenge. Those new to the profession or in the early years of their career will benefit from extensive foundational training, and all teachers have access to personalised career development programmes.
The successful candidate will also be expected to contribute to the co-curricular and pastoral life of a thriving boarding school.
Business and Economics are two of the most popular A Level subjects at Shrewsbury School. They enjoy a strong reputation, with excellent Public Examination results, and a number of leavers each year going on to pursue Economics, Business, or related studies at university, including at top UK and international universities.
A full induction programme is provided for all new members of staff, in addition to a programme of continuous professional development. The salary for the post is competitive, and accommodation may be available. All new members of staff are issued with a touch screen laptop device to assist their teaching.
